NetTcpPortSharing ne peut pas démarrer l'erreur sous Windows: comment y remédier

Erreur de démarrage de NetTcpPortSharing

Les services Windows sont des programmes qui s'exécutent en arrière-plan pendant que nous utilisons le système d'exploitation. Ils peuvent être démarrés manuellement, automatiquement ou lorsqu'un événement se produit. L'un d'eux est le service de partage de port NetTcpPortSharing Dans certaines situations, même si nous l'avons configuré pour démarrer automatiquement, cela peut ne pas fonctionner. Dans ce didacticiel, nous allons expliquer comment dépanner le service de partage de port Net.Tcp ne peut pas démarrer sous Windows.

Au cas où vous ne le sauriez pas, le Service de partage de port NetTcpPortSharing est celui qui permet à plusieurs utilisateurs de partager des ports TCP via le protocole Net.Tcp. Il est à noter que, par défaut, le service de partage de port Net.Tcp est désactivé, nous devons donc l'activer manuellement la première fois que nous l'utilisons.

Quelle erreur indique que NetTcpPortSharing ne peut pas démarrer

À un moment donné, certains utilisateurs de Windows ont dû faire face à un problème avec le service de partage de port lorsque NetTcpPortSharing ne peut pas démarrer. Dans cette situation, ils ont reçu un message d'erreur de ce type ou similaire à celui que nous mettons ci-dessous.

Dans ce message, il explique que le service NetTcpPortSharing n'a pas pu démarrer en raison d'une erreur. Plus précisément, la demande d'initiation ou de contrôle n'a pas été correctement traitée. De plus, lorsqu'ils sont allés à l'observateur d'événements Windows, ils n'ont trouvé aucun fait pertinent qui leur explique pourquoi NetTcpPortSharing ne peut pas démarrer.

Quant aux solutions que nous pouvons mettre en œuvre pour résoudre le problème sont:

  • Mettre le service de partage de port NetTcpPortSharing sur démarrage automatique
  • Activez la dépendance sur .NET Framework 3.5.
  • La réinitialisation de Winsock.
  • Restaurez le système.

Ensuite, nous expliquerons comment effectuer chacun d'eux correctement.

Configuration du service NetTcpPortSharing pour le démarrage automatique

Parfois, le service de partage de port NetTcpPortSharing peut rester bloqué dans un état où il ne peut pas être ouvert ou fermé. Cela provoque l'échec du démarrage de NetTcpPortSharing, et pour le résoudre, nous allons suivre ces étapes:

  • Nous appuyons sur Windows + R combinaison de touches pour appeler la boîte de dialogue Exécuter. Nous pourrions également le faire à partir du menu Démarrer de Windows.
  • In Courir , nous tapons services.msc et appuyez sur Entrée pour ouvrir Nos Services .
  • Dans la partie droite de la fenêtre Services, nous devons localiser le Service de partage de port NetTcpPortSharing .
  • Nous double-cliquons sur l'entrée pour éditer ses propriétés.
  • Nous vérifions que l'option dans le Type de démarrage Le menu de la fenêtre des propriétés du service est défini sur   Automatique .

Ce serait l'écran de service et dans les cases rouges sont indiqués où vous devez apporter les modifications.

La prochaine chose que nous devons faire est:

  1. Cliquez sur Appliquer et  OK pour enregistrer les modifications.
  2. Nous fermons les services.
  3. Nous redémarrons l'ordinateur.

Dans le cas hypothétique où le service est déjà défini à automatique , puis on clique sur le Arrêter bouton dans le État du service puis nous l'activons en cliquant sur le Accueil bouton .

Activer la dépendance sur .NET Framework 3.5

Une autre raison pour laquelle NetTcpPortSharing ne peut pas être démarré peut être liée à Net Framework 3.5. Dans ce cas, pour résoudre le problème, nous allons suivre cette procédure:

  • Le menu Démarrer.
  • Nous écrivons Courir et appuyez sur Entrée.
  • Dans Run, nous tapons appwiz.cpl  et  Press entrer
  • Une fois à l'intérieur Programmes et fonctionnalités sur le côté gauche, nous cliquons sur  Activer ou désactiver les fonctionnalités Windows  .
  • Dans la fenêtre contextuelle qui apparaît, appuyez sur le bouton . NET Framework 3.5 puis cliquez sur le signe + pour développer la section.
  • Maintenant, sélectionnez les cases Activation de HTTP Windows Communication Foundation   et   Activation non HTTP  Fondation de communication Windows  .
  • Pour finir on touche OK  pour enregistrer les modifications.

Voici une capture d'écran où vous pouvez voir les boîtes NET Framework 3.5 que nous devons activer:

Si nous constatons que les deux options sont déjà définies, nous les supprimons pour les désactiver temporairement et redémarrer l'ordinateur. Ensuite, nous revenons ici et les activons à nouveau. Enfin, nous redémarrons et vérifions si cela fonctionne correctement.

Réinitialiser Winsock

La réinitialisation de Winsock nous aidera à résoudre les erreurs liées au protocole de contrôle de transmission et aux protocoles Internet. Pour ce faire, nous irons à la Menu Démarrer , écrire Invite de commandes et faites un clic droit dessus, en choisissant de Exécuter en tant qu'administrateur .

symbole du système

Ensuite, nous mettons la commande suivante et appuyez sur Entrée:

netsh winsock resetDe cette façon, je réinitialiserai toutes les valeurs par défaut du réseau local et vous ne devriez plus avoir de problèmes avec l'erreur NetTcpPortSharing sur les systèmes d'exploitation Windows.

Restaurer le système

Une restauration système est essentiellement la mise en miroir fidèle des fichiers Windows et d'autres fichiers d'application installés sur votre système à un moment précis. Si nous avons cette option activée, cela peut être une bonne solution lorsque NetTcpPortSharing ne peut pas être démarré, car nous reviendrions à une époque où cela fonctionnait correctement.

Pour cela, dans le Accueil Menu   nous écrivons voitures classiques . Ensuite, un écran comme celui-ci apparaîtra:

Ensuite, nous cliquons sur la restauration du système puis nous choisissons le point de restauration qui nous intéresse le plus. Enfin, une autre option consiste à restaurer une sauvegarde que nous avons du système d'exploitation dans un état antérieur, au cas où vous n'utilisez pas l'option de restauration du système de Windows 10 lui-même, il existe des programmes de sauvegarde très avancés qui nous permettront un clone de notre disque dur ou SSD pour le restaurer plus tard quand nous le voulons.

L'un des programmes les plus populaires est Acronis True Image, un programme payant qui nous permet de faire des sauvegardes et des restaurations très avancées, nous pouvons crypter la sauvegarde, transférer la copie vers un serveur Samba sur le réseau local, vers un serveur FTP local ou distant , et nous pouvons même utiliser le cloud Acronis pour héberger la sauvegarde sur Internet, afin de ne pas avoir à la stocker localement sur un disque dur externe.

Avec toutes ces étapes que nous vous avons expliquées, vous devriez déjà avoir résolu l'erreur survenue dans Windows 10 au premier moment.